Web11 feb. 2008 · Mildred Taylor: By the time I wrote Roll of Thunder, Hear My Cry, I thought there would be three or four Logan books, for I wanted to tell the history of my father’s generation from the time my father was a boy in the 1930’s, through the days of World War II, to the beginning of the Civil Rights Movement. I planned for all these books to be novels. Web23 feb. 2024 · Taylor began to take her family's stories and use them for inspiration in her writing.
